Obituary for Marilyn Joan Neale (Ellis)

Marilyn Joan Neale passed peacefully with her daughter by her side on Tuesday, May 3, 2016. Marilyn was born October 22, 1941 in Hamilton, Ontario to William Dunlop and Mary Ella (Demaline) Ellis. She was the beloved spouse of the late William Jay Neale. Treasured mother and best friend of Shelley Kelly (Paul), of Hamilton, and Gregory (Jessica Warren), of Castlemaine, Australia. A very proud and loving "Grandma Marilyn" of Alannah, Michaela and Siobhan Kelly and Lewis, Indygo and Tilly Neale. She was the much loved sister of the late David Ellis and loved Auntie "M" to his children Tara, Lisa, Lara, William, Natasha and their families. She also leaves behind her wonderful friend Henry Rapcewicz as well as many other relatives, friends and colleagues whose lives she touched. Marilyn grew up in Hamilton in a loving family. She was a proud graduate of St. Joseph's School of Nursing Class of 62. Her kindness and compassion led to a wonderful career in nursing and she was a strong advocate for the elderly. Marilyn was a founding member of St. Margaret Mary Parish in Hamilton. Marilyn retired in 2003 and enjoyed spending time with her children, grandchildren, nieces, nephews and many close friends. She loved to travel, read, and was always ready for a new adventure. She did not let illness define her and was a great example of living in the moment and never giving up. Following her wishes, a funeral mass was celebrated at St. Margaret Mary Roman Catholic Church with family and close friends.
